Performance Metrics

Tracking cost and revenue is crucial for analyzing ad placements and improving ROI. Here are three key metrics to focus on:

  • CAC (Customer Acquisition Cost): Total campaign spend ÷ number of new customers acquired
  • CPC (Cost Per Click): Total ad spend ÷ number of clicks
  • ROAS (Return on Ad Spend): Revenue generated ÷ ad spend

5 Steps to Analyze Ad Placement

Want to get the most out of your ad placements? Follow these five steps to make data-driven decisions and improve your campaign performance:

  1. Set Clear Goals

Define what you want to achieve with your campaign:

  • Drive product adoption
  • Build brand awareness
  • Generate qualified leads
  • Boost event sign-ups
  • Increase website traffic

Each goal comes with its own success metrics. For example, if product adoption is your focus, track conversion rates and user activation. For brand awareness, keep an eye on impression shares and engagement rates.

  1. Use Analysis Tools

Keep track of these key metrics to evaluate performance:

Metric Category

What to Monitor

User Behavior

Time on page, scroll depth, interaction points

Campaign Performance

Impressions, clicks, conversions

Revenue Impact

ROAS, revenue per click, total revenue

Audience Insights

Demographics, interests, engagement patterns

These insights will help you understand what’s working and where adjustments are needed.

  1. Test Different Versions

Experiment with various elements of your ads to see what resonates best:

  • Ad copy length and tone
  • Visuals and creative assets
  • Call-to-action placement and wording
  • Targeting parameters

Use control groups and ensure your tests run long enough to gather reliable data.

ROI Improvement Methods

Increase your ROI by fine-tuning audience targeting, ad scheduling, and ad formats.

Target Audience Settings

Accurate targeting is key to better performance. Here are some important factors to consider:

Key Parameters for ROI Boost

Impact on ROI

Seniority Level

Match content to the audience's expertise for better engagement

Programming Languages

Tailor ads to developers using specific technologies

Tool Usage

Target users familiar with relevant tools and platforms

You can combine these parameters to create more specific segments. For example, focus on senior Python developers who work with cloud technologies.

Once your audience is set, focus on when they see your ads.

Schedule Optimization

  • Peak Activity Windows: Run ads during hours when your audience is most active.
  • Time Zone Distribution: Make sure ads display consistently across different regions.
  • Content Release Patterns: Time ads to align with content launches or high-traffic moments.

Track engagement data to fine-tune your schedule for maximum impact.

High-Performance Ad Types

The format of your ad plays a big role in engagement. Here are some effective options:

  • In-Feed Ads: These blend seamlessly with content. Use concise, technical copy and maintain consistent visuals.
  • Post Page Ads: Place these near relevant discussions. Add interactivity and highlight clear technical advantages.
  • Personalized Digest Ads: Tailor these to user preferences. Include relatable use cases, performance stats, and testimonials from developers.

Choose ad formats that best support your campaign goals and resonate with your audience.
